    Hamilton County will now be served by two ladder trucks at the Aurora and Giltner fire departments. Aurora passed off its green 65-foot ladder truck to Giltner Fire Chief Brad Consbruck (left) last week, and Aurora Fire Chief Tom Cox welcomed a 100-foot ladder truck to the Aurora fleet.
Thanks to conversation between friends and a special program offered by the Nebraska (and U.S) Forest Service, both the Aurora and Giltner volunteer fire departments received new pieces to their firefighting fleet.
